Group practices are one of Headway's biggest growth levers and one of its most complex design challenges. Unlike solo providers, group practices operate through owners, admins, supervisors, and supervisees, each with different permissions, workflows, and goals. A single group practice might onboard dozens of providers simultaneously, manage supervisory billing relationships across multiple states, and need practice-level reporting that doesn't exist today.
As a Staff Product Designer for Group Practices, you'll be the design anchor for the only segment-based pod at Headway. You won't just own a surface, you'll own a customer. That means designing across the full lifecycle: from how group practices discover and join Headway, to how they onboard and activate supervisees, to how they manage packaging tiers and track practice performance.
